This multi-modal, opioid-free anesthetic (OFA) regimen was developed and studied by the Medical University of Silesia for the management of acute intraoperative and postoperative pain in patients undergoing thoracic surgery. The regimen is designed to provide effective analgesia while mitigating the respiratory complications and other adverse effects typically associated with opioid-based anesthesia in this clinical setting. It consists of a regional anesthetic component—a single-shot thoracic paravertebral block (ThPVB) using **bupivacaine**—combined with systemic non-opioid analgesics administered intravenously, specifically **lidocaine** and **ketamine**. Bupivacaine and lidocaine function as local anesthetics by blocking voltage-gated sodium channels, thereby inhibiting the initiation and conduction of nerve impulses. Ketamine acts as a non-competitive antagonist at the N-methyl-D-aspartate (NMDA) receptor, providing potent analgesia and preventing central sensitization. This combination was evaluated in a randomized controlled trial (NCT04141306) against standard opioid-based anesthesia using fentanyl.
